Azimuthal correlations of hadrons with high transverse momenta serve as a
measure to study the energy loss and the fragmentation pattern of jets emerging
from hard parton-parton interactions in heavy ion collisions. Preliminary
results from the CERES experiment on two- and three-particle correlations in
central Pb-Au collisions are presented. A strongly non-Gaussian shape on the
away-side of the two-particle correlation function is observed, indicating
significant interactions of the emerging partons with the medium. Mechanisms
like deflection of the initial partons or the evolution of a mach cone in the
medium can lead to similar modifications of the jet structure on the away-side.
An analysis based on three-particle correlations is presented which helps to
shed light on the origin of the observed away-side pattern.Comment: 4 pages, 2 figures, contribution to the Quark Matter conference 200
